> I took part in my first motorkana on the weekend - great fun, but..
> in between events a couple of club members noticed how high the rear of my
> car sits.
> 
> Inspection below revealed that the quarter elliptics point down towards the
> ground at the rear of the car ie rear end of rear suspension, instead of
> being sort of horizontal.  Note:  My Sprite is the only one I've ever
> looked underneath and it has always looked like it does now, so I'm just
> going on other's explanations.
> 
> Everyone agreed that it looked very wrong, but there were differing
> opinions as the cause and cure.   Some thought the springs were broken,
> others that they "need to be reset by a springworks".  in the end I was
> just left confused.  Both sides look the same.
> 
> I would appreciate the views on the list about what might be wrong.
> 
> One thought I have had.   Is it possible to put the springs in upside down?

The Leafs (1/4) on both my Bugeyes do indeed point down at the axle
mount.
If your springs are relativly new, (past 10 years or so) the
replacements are way over sprung making our Bugeyes look like jacked up
little Chevys.
A good spring shop can de-arch your leafs to make the car sit level.
Look in the phone book under truck suspension or springs.
